Use Plain Language

When it comes to crafting API error messages, using plain language is essential. Avoid using technical terms, jargon, or vague language that may confuse your users. Instead, opt for simple and direct language that clearly explains what went wrong, why it happened, and how to fix it.

For example, instead of an ambiguous “Invalid input” message, provide a specific instruction like “Please enter a valid email address”. By using plain language, you can ensure that your error messages are easily understood by all users, regardless of their technical background.

Remember to use an active voice and maintain a positive tone in your error messages. Avoid blaming or shaming users for the error. Instead, focus on providing helpful guidance and solutions. By adopting a user-centric approach and using plain language, you can create error messages that are clear, approachable, and user-friendly.

Provide Context and Guidance

In addition to informing users about the problem, API error messages should also provide context and guidance. When encountering an error, users need to understand what went wrong, why it happened, and how to resolve it. Providing context not only helps users troubleshoot more effectively but also improves their overall experience.

To provide context in error messages, include relevant details that help users understand the cause and scope of the error. For example, instead of displaying a generic “Server error” message, provide a more specific error description, such as “We apologize for the inconvenience. Our servers are currently undergoing maintenance. Please try again later.”

Furthermore, it is crucial to guide users towards appropriate actions to resolve the error. Suggest specific steps they can take or provide links, buttons, or instructions that facilitate the resolution process. This guidance empowers users to address the issue and move forward. For instance, for a login error, prompt users to double-check their credentials or offer a password reset option.

Take a look at the example below to see how context and guidance can be incorporated into an error message:

Error: Invalid credentials

We were unable to authenticate your account using the provided credentials.

Double-check that your email and password are correct, and ensure that there are no typing mistakes.

If you’ve forgotten your password, you can reset it here.

If you continue to experience issues, please contact our support team for further assistance.

By providing context and guidance in API error messages, you empower users to understand the problem and take appropriate actions to resolve it. This not only reduces frustration but also enhances user satisfaction and confidence in your application.

Be Consistent and Concise

Consistency and conciseness are crucial when it comes to creating effective API error messages. By maintaining a consistent style, format, and tone throughout your web app, you can avoid confusion and build trust with your users. Using a standard template or format for your error messages and following the same conventions for capitalization, punctuation, and grammar will contribute to a cohesive and polished user experience.

Furthermore, keeping your error messages concise and focused on essential information is key. Avoid using unnecessary words or repetition that may overwhelm or confuse users. Instead, provide them with clear and straightforward messages that convey the necessary details to understand and resolve the error.

For example, instead of saying:

“We’re sorry, we couldn’t process your request because there was an error on our server.”

Say:

“We couldn’t process your request. Please try again later.”

By being consistent in your message style and ensuring your error messages are concise, you can create a seamless and user-friendly experience for your API users.

Example Error Message Template

Error Code Error Message
400 The request parameters are invalid. Please review your input and try again.
401 Access denied. Please make sure you are authorized to access this resource.
404 The requested resource was not found. Please check the URL and try again.

Follow Accessibility Standards

To make your API error messages accessible to all users, it is important to adhere to the Web Content Accessibility Guidelines (WCAG). By following these guidelines, you can ensure that your error messages are perceivable, operable, understandable, and robust. This will enable users of different abilities and preferences to effectively interact with your API error messages.

Here are some key considerations to keep in mind:

  • Use contrast colors, icons, and sounds to indicate errors, making them easily distinguishable for all users.
  • Provide alternative text and captions for images and audio in your error messages, ensuring that users with visual or hearing impairments can access the information.
  • Use clear and simple language and structure in your error messages, avoiding complex or ambiguous wording that may confuse users.
  • Ensure that your error messages are keyboard and screen reader-friendly, allowing users who rely on assistive technologies to navigate and understand the content.

By following accessibility standards, you can make your API error messages inclusive and accessible to a wide range of users, promoting equal access and usability.

Importance of Secure Error Message Handling

Error messages can inadvertently expose sensitive information if not handled securely. They can potentially reveal system vulnerabilities and become entry points for unauthorized access.

Your API error messages should be designed with security in mind, ensuring that they do not provide any malicious actor with opportunities to exploit your system.

“Ensuring security in API error messages prevents the leak of sensitive information and mitigates potential security threats.”

Protecting User Data in Error Messages

Implementing data protection measures is vital when it comes to error message handling. Avoid displaying any personally identifiable information (PII) or sensitive data in your error messages.

Instead, focus on providing clear and concise information about the error without disclosing any sensitive details. This approach will help maintain the privacy and security of your users’ data.

Error Message Secure Handling
Password is incorrect Provide a generic error message without revealing whether it was the username or password that is incorrect. This prevents potential attackers from guessing valid usernames.
Email address is already registered Avoid including the specific email address in the error message to prevent exposure of users’ personal information. Instead, use a general message like “This email address is already in use.”
Internal server error Provide a generic error message without disclosing any specific details about the internal server error to prevent potential attackers from gaining insights into your system architecture or vulnerabilities.

By following secure error message handling practices and protecting user data, you can promote trust, maintain the confidentiality of sensitive information, and protect your system from potential security threats.
